Privacy Trees Planting in Ventura County, CA

Privacy trees planting services focus on adding strategic greenery to residential properties to enhance privacy and create a natural barrier. These projects typically involve selecting appropriate tree species, such as evergreen or fast-growing varieties, and planting them in specific areas like property lines, yards, or around outdoor living spaces. Homeowners often seek this service to reduce visibility from neighbors, block noise, or establish a secluded outdoor environment, making it important to consider factors like soil conditions, sunlight exposure, and future growth when planning a planting project.

Before requesting privacy trees planting, property owners usually want to understand the types of trees suitable for their location, the maintenance involved, and how the mature trees will impact their landscape. It’s helpful to consider the size and growth rate of the trees, potential root system effects on nearby structures, and the overall aesthetic they desire. Gathering information about local climate conditions and any relevant regulations can also ensure the selected trees thrive and comply with community guidelines.

Privacy Trees Planting Questions

What are Privacy Trees used for? Privacy trees are planted to create natural screens that block views and reduce noise between properties.

Which types of trees are suitable for privacy purposes? Fast-growing evergreen trees like arborvitae, cypress, and holly are commonly used for privacy hedges.

How should privacy trees be spaced? Spacing depends on the tree type and desired privacy level, but typically they are planted 3 to 5 feet apart for a dense screen.

Are privacy trees appropriate for all property sizes? Privacy trees can be adapted to various yard sizes, from small gardens to large landscapes, to enhance privacy effectively.
